Story points are units of measure for expressing an estimate of the overall effort required to fully implement a product backlog item or any other piece of work. WebApr 15, 2024 · T-shirt sizing is a common way to size epics. Another way is to say we think it could take X to Y iterations to do this work. Epics are usually defined during initial product roadmapping and decomposed into stories in the product backlog as more is learned. Story - something actionable and small enough to fit in a sprint.
